t6 vi nb yr c8 0q 0o 48 nq qt 7w ig hk 05 71 34 of kl 2q 7n la go zv 27 57 7u n2 84 p2 yp qh 68 8x 2r p2 pi v9 6g nk jd 77 xm p5 14 uq e4 az 4z gx 3g ew
8 d
t6 vi nb yr c8 0q 0o 48 nq qt 7w ig hk 05 71 34 of kl 2q 7n la go zv 27 57 7u n2 84 p2 yp qh 68 8x 2r p2 pi v9 6g nk jd 77 xm p5 14 uq e4 az 4z gx 3g ew
WebAug 30, 2024 · KERNEL: UVM_WARNING uvm_reg_map.svh(1558) @ 0: reporter [UVM/REG/ADDR] this version of UVM does not properly support memories with a … http://cluelogic.com/2014/09/uvm-tutorial-for-candy-lovers-register-access-through-the-back-door/ blair men's shoes WebBackdoors. class uvm.reg.uvm_reg_backdoor.UVMRegBackdoor(name='') [source] ¶. Bases: uvm.base.uvm_object.UVMObject. async do_pre_read(rw) [source] ¶. Task: … WebUVM Backdoor Access Misc Utilities UVM HDL routines UVM Pool UVM Comparer. UVM Register Environment . In Register Model, we have seen how to create a model that represents actual registers in a design. ... // … admin assistant jobs canary wharf WebDec 1, 2024 · B. Modified UVM Backdoor classes for Coverage Sampling. Again, from the UVM User Guide, we have this section ... B. Blais, "Reusable UVM REG backdoor automation," in DVCon, India, 2014. Automated ... WebJan 15, 2024 · When this method returns, the mirror value for the register corresponding to this instance of the backdoor class will be updated via a backdoor read operation. Section 5.6.6 Active Monitoring of the UVM User's Guide. ... You can find the code in uvm_reg.svh predict() function which will lead you to the uvm_reg_field.svh. ... blair mens leather jackets WebFeb 13, 2024 · 1 Answer. The whole point of backdoor access with zero delay. You'll need to delay issuing the backdoor write command by the number of cycles you want. Thanks for replying Dave. What I'm specifically asking is if there's a way to customize uvm_reg 's write function with backdoor access to do what I want to do, by way of callbacks or such.
You can also add your opinion below!
What Girls & Guys Said
WebThe uvm_object class is the base class for all UVM data and hierarchical classes. virtual class uvm_reg_block extends uvm_object. Block abstraction base class. uvm_path_e default_path = UVM_DEFAULT_PATH. Default access path for the registers and memories in this block. function new (. string. name. =. WebUVM students can enter the 100% Online Certificate program three times a year, Spring (April), Summer (July), Fall (September). How to Apply Contact your UVM home campus … admin assistant jobs cape town http://cluelogic.com/2014/09/uvm-tutorial-for-candy-lovers-register-access-through-the-back-door/ Webtypedef class uvm_reg_cbs; //-----// Class: uvm_reg_backdoor // // Base class for user-defined back-door register and memory access. // // This class can be extended by users to provide user-specific back-door access // to registers and memories that are not implemented in pure SystemVerilog // or that are not accessible using the default DPI ... blair mens shoes Webuvm_reg_backdoor. Base class for user-defined back-door register and memory access. This class can be extended by users to provide user-specific back-door access to … // ----- // typedef class uvm_reg_cbs; //----- // Class: uvm_reg_backdoor // // Base … WebFeb 13, 2024 · To do this we would need to map the register access to a series of transactions from the UVM agent. In those cases, the UVM register frontdoor sequence, uvm_reg_frontdoor, is the king. The uvm_register_frontdoor looks like a normal uvm_sequence apart from having the uvm_reg_item rw_info that holds information … blair mens short sleeve shirts WebUVM also allows backdoor accesses which uses a simulator database to directly access the signals within the DUT. Write operations deposit a value onto the signal and read operations sample the current value from the …
WebMar 20, 2013 · I am trying to implement register backdoor access with user defined register backdoor by extending uvm_reg_backdoor. class peri_reg_backdoor extends uvm_reg_backdoor virtual task write(uvm_reg_item rw); admin assistant job interview questions and answers Webtypedef class uvm_reg_cbs; //-----// Class: uvm_reg_backdoor // // Base class for user-defined back-door register and memory access. // // This class can be extended by … Webtypedef class uvm_mem; typedef class uvm_reg_backdoor; //-----// Title: Register Callbacks // // This section defines the base class used for all register callback // extensions. It also includes pre-defined callback extensions for use on // … blair men's fleece sweatpants WebSep 14, 2014 · The line 32 uses the poke_reg task of the uvm_reg_sequence class. The line 36 uses the write_reg task of the uvm_reg_sequence class with the UVM_BACKDOOR option. The line 41 uses the write task of the uvm_reg class with the UVM_BACKDOOR option. Similarly, we read the TASTE register through the back door … WebUVM students pursuing a Chicago campus dual degree option at NLU will need to study at NLU on an F-1 visa. Once admitted to NLU’s Chicago campus dual degree program, … blair mens shorts Webossswebcs.admin.uillinois.edu
WebFeb 13, 2024 · 1 Answer. The whole point of backdoor access with zero delay. You'll need to delay issuing the backdoor write command by the number of cycles you want. Thanks for … blair men's shirt jacket WebNational Louis University offers accessible, affordable, career-driven higher education. Our personalized programs are designed to advance your career, whether you're passionate … blair mens shirts